The comfort you are looking for is available, and it can be found in Jesus Christ. Jesus is the Son of God, and He is the one who comforts His people. In Isaiah 40:1, God says, "Comfort, comfort my people." This verse shows that God is the one who comforts His people, and He is the one who can bring peace and comfort in the midst of troubles.
To find comfort in Jesus, you need to ask for it. You need to ask to have eyes open to see the presence of God in your life. You need to look for where the Father is at work and join in. This means that you need to be present in the moment and breathe in the presence of God. You need to seek God's help and ask Him to show you how to make your home a safe haven. By doing this, you can find comfort and peace in the midst of troubles.
The comfort that Jesus brings is not just a feeling, but it is a real and tangible presence. It is a comfort that strengthens and encourages us in the midst of troubles. It is a comfort that is available to us because of Jesus' death and resurrection. By trusting in Jesus and His power, we can find comfort and peace, even in the midst of difficult circumstances. So, if you are looking for comfort, look to Jesus. Ask for His presence in your life, and seek to be present in His presence. This is where you will find true comfort and peace.
